Anzac Day 1970
Anzac Day services were held throughout the Nelson district. The morning was devoted to remembrance of the dead and in the afternoon sports were played. In Nelson, the number of former servicemen to parade was much smaller than in the past, as was the crowd at the main service. This pic was taken as wreaths were laid at the memorial.
